USA - The recently-opened Bankroll is a new take on a Philadelphia sports bar. This 13,000sq.ft and 350+ seat restaurant and entertainment-viewing social experience is an impressive addition to Center City’s nightlife. Electrosonic led the audio/video system installation, outfitting this elevated sports bar with an installed 1 Sound audio system and 1,200sq.ft LED screens. Bankroll was built in the restored 1928 art-deco Boyd Theatre.
For the main entertainment and bar space the two-level Big Game Room sits behind the theatre’s restored marquee. On either side of the centre wall LED screen is a 1 Sound Tower 2 System hung as the room’s main PA system. The Tower 2 System, consists of one Tower LCC84 rigged to a SUB310 using the Tower Rigging System accessory.
This system is commonly configured as a system that sits on the floor, however, for this application Electrosonic hung the subwoofer and the Tower cardioid column with the desired angle. The Tower LCC84 has a wide dispersion of 120 degrees with a premiere clarity that shines for the TV playback audio that will be amplified. The cardioid behaviour helps limit room reflections in this multilevel space where the original art-deco stain glass is situated behind the main speaker hangs, resulting in more sonic intelligibility for the space.
In the off-set dining rooms, Electrosonic installed Cannon C6s above the screens with distributed WSUB45s mounted to the wall using their dedicated C-Clamp. Bankroll is set up to entertain private events and viewing parties, so Cannon C5s are also used on either side of screens in dedicated private event areas. The energetic atmosphere is set from the minute you walk in, with two full-range Cannon C6 situated in the reception area.
